WebWichita Technical Service Department 6200 South Ridge Road, Wichita, KS 67215 Tel: 800-733-1165 ext. 1 [email protected] Carbon Tetrachloride Specific … WebDensity of Carbon tetrachloride g mm3 = 0.0016 g/mm³. Density of Carbon tetrachloride kg m3 = 1 594 kg/m³. Density of Carbon tetrachloride lb in3 = 0.058 lb/in³. Density of Carbon tetrachloride lb ft3 = 99.51 lb/ft³. For example, the density of water at 16 o C is 999 kg/m 3 while the density of mercury at 20 o C is 13,550 kg/m 3. In order for an object to float in a liquid, the density of the object must be less than that of the liquid.
